

Aider — лучший выбор для разработчиков, работающих с существующими кодовыми базами на Python, JavaScript, TypeScript и других языках, кому нужен AI-ассистент, интегрированный в терминал и Git. v0 by Vercel — идеальный инструмент для фронтенд-дизайнеров и разработчиков, которым нужно быстро создать прототип React-компонента с Tailwind CSS по текстовому описанию. Если ваша задача — рефакторинг, отладка и написание логики в проекте — выбирайте Aider. Если нужно визуальное оформление интерфейса «из промпта в код» — выбирайте v0.
| Критерий | Aider | v0 by Vercel |
|---|---|---|
| Цена | Бесплатно (Open Source). Требуется API-ключ от LLM (GPT-4, Claude и др.) — оплата по токенам (~$0.03–0.15 за сессию). | Бесплатно 200 кредитов/мес. Далее от $20/мес за 1000 кредитов. 1 кредит ≈ 1 запрос. |
| Функциональность | Редактирование кода в любых файлах, рефакторинг, генерация функций, работа с Git (автоматические коммиты), поддержка 50+ языков. | Генерация React-компонентов с Tailwind CSS, создание UI-макетов, экспорт в JSX/TSX. Ограничен только фронтендом. |
| Простота использования | Требует установки Python, настройки API-ключа и работы в командной строке. Средний порог входа. | Веб-интерфейс (chat.vercel.ai). Не требует установки. Минимальный порог входа. |
| Интеграции | Git, любая IDE (через терминал), CI/CD пайплайны. Работает с любыми файлами в проекте. | Vercel (деплой одним кликом), GitHub (импорт репозитория). Ограничен экосистемой Vercel. |
| Производительность | Зависит от модели LLM (GPT-4 Turbo — быстро, Claude 3 Opus — медленнее). Может обрабатывать файлы до 1000+ строк. | Быстрая генерация компонентов (2–5 секунд). Ограничен размером промпта (до 4000 символов). |
Aider — это open-source AI-агент, который работает непосредственно в вашем терминале и автоматически синхронизируется с Git. Его главная сила — контекстное понимание всего проекта: он видит структуру файлов, импорты и зависимости, что позволяет ему предлагать осмысленные изменения, а не просто вставки кода. Aider поддерживает множество моделей (GPT-4, Claude, Llama) и умеет самостоятельно выполнять команды терминала (например, запустить тесты после изменений). Ограничение: требует базовых навыков работы с командной строкой и не имеет графического интерфейса для визуального дизайна.
v0 — это генеративный AI-инструмент, специализирующийся на создании React-компонентов с Tailwind CSS. Вы пишете промпт на естественном языке (например, «сделай карточку товара с ценой и кнопкой "Купить"»), и v0 возвращает готовый JSX-код с корректной разметкой и стилями. Инструмент идеален для быстрого прототипирования интерфейсов: он генерирует адаптивные компоненты, поддерживает тёмную тему и экспорт в проект Vercel. Ограничение: v0 не умеет редактировать существующий код за пределами сгенерированного компонента, не работает с бэкендом и не поддерживает языки, кроме JavaScript/TypeScript.
Если вы пишете серверный код, работаете с данными или поддерживаете сложную кодовую базу — используйте Aider. Он бесплатен, гибок и глубоко интегрируется в ваш рабочий процесс. Если ваша задача — быстро получить красивый React-компонент с Tailwind без возни с CSS — выбирайте v0 by Vercel. Для максимальной эффективности можно комбинировать оба инструмента: v0 для UI, Aider для логики и интеграции.